|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#1 |
|
Junior Member
Iscritto dal: Oct 2008
Messaggi: 11
|
[c++] problema compilazione
ciao a tutti sto progettando un circuito con dei led collegato alla porta parallela del pc con win 98 il problema è che non riesco a creare il programma per la porta parallela cioè non riesco a compilarlo. Qualcuno sa trovarmi l'errore ???
Questa è la mia idea: #include <iostream> #include <conio.h> #include <dos.h> using namespace std; main() { cout << "Ha inizio la scrittura: led tutti spenti e poi tutti accesi"; outportb(0x378, 0x00); outportb(0x378, 0xff); cout << "Fine"; getch(); return 0; } P.s. come compilatore utilizzo dev c++ v. 4.9.9.2 grazie mille in anticipo.... |
|
|
|
|
|
#2 | |
|
Senior Member
Iscritto dal: Apr 2000
Città: Vicino a Montecatini(Pistoia) Moto:Kawasaki Ninja ZX-9R Scudetti: 29
Messaggi: 53971
|
Quote:
Tutte quelle segnate in rosso sono librerie e funzioni non standard che non sono presenti su Dev C++ (nel compilatore MinGW32). O meglio, conio.h è presente per compatibilità con i compilatori Microsoft, ma è molto limitata. In Dev-C++ non esistono, che io sappia, funzioni per l'accesso diretto all'hardware. Questo è normale perché in tutti i sistemi derivati da Windows NT non è possibile usarle !!! |
|
|
|
|
|
|
#3 |
|
Senior Member
Iscritto dal: Mar 2007
Messaggi: 1792
|
Prova i metodi elencati in Parallel Port Programming o usa un vecchio compilatore a 16-bit (es. Turbo C/C++).
|
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 06:23.




















